Step the Door Frame:Height: Measure the height from the leading to the bottom of the frame.Width: Measure the width at the leading, middle, and bottom.Depth: Determine the density of the frame.2. Select the Right Door:Ensure the new door matches the measurements. Think about the kind of door and material based upon your choice and needs.3. Prepare the Area:Clear the area around the current door. Eliminate any trim or molding if essential.4. Remove the Old Door:Use a screwdriver to remove the door from its hinges and eliminate it from the frame.5. Install the New Door Frame (if appropriate):If it's a pre-hung door, place the door frame in the opening. Utilize a level to ensure it's straight. Secure it using screws.6. Attach the New Door:Align the door with the hinges on the frame. Use screws to connect the hinges securely.7. Change and Level the Door:Check that the door opens and closes smoothly. Use wood shims to adjust if needed, ensuring it's level.8. Seal and Insulate:Use caulking to seal spaces around the frame. Add weatherstripping to improve energy effectiveness.9. Include Finishing Touches:Reinstall any trim or molding around the door. A: A basic door installation can take anywhere from 2 to 4 hours, depending upon the kind of door and the intricacy of the installation.
Q: Do I need to work with a professional to install a door?
A: While DIY installation is possible for those with some experience, working with a professional is recommended for best results, specifically for Custom Wooden Doors or heavy doors.
Q: What is the cost of installing a new door?
A: Costs can differ extensively based on the kind of door, materials, and labor, generally varying from ₤ 100 to ₤ 1,500.
Q: How do I maintain my new door?
A: Regularly check hinges for rust, check weatherstripping, and clean the door occasionally to maintain its condition.
Q: What should I do if my new door doesn't fit?
A: If a door doesn't fit, examine the measurements and change the frame or trim as essential. If it's a considerable issue, professional aid may be required.
